A tool designed to automate the process of determining the quantity of materials required for constructing a pole barn. This calculator typically takes into account dimensions such as length, width, height, bay spacing, roof pitch, and door/window sizes to generate a detailed accounting of lumber, metal roofing/siding, fasteners, concrete, and other necessary components. For example, inputting specific dimensions into such a tool instantly calculates the linear feet of lumber needed for posts, girts, and purlins.
The significance of utilizing such an instrument lies in its ability to enhance project accuracy, minimize material waste, and streamline the budgeting phase. Accurate material estimation prevents costly over- or under-ordering, ensuring efficient resource allocation.
